Liposuction, also known as "suction lipectomy" or "lipoplasty", is currently the most popular cosmetic procedure in North America. This type of surgery can be completed in a few hours and works best on people of normal weight with specific areas of fatty deposits. These aspects of the operation give it a false sense of ease and safety, which gives this issue positive and negative sides.
